A spoon used as a cathode is dipped in `AgNO_(3)` solution and a current of 0.2 amp is passed for one hour. Calculate
how much silver plating has occurred ?
(b) how many electrons were involved in the process ?
(c) what amount of copper would have been plated under similar conditions ?

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

`0.805 g, 4.5 xx 10^(21), 0.237 g`
